Water management is a crucial aspect of golf course maintenance, and the Certificate in Golf Course Water Management is designed to equip professionals with the knowledge and skills to optimize water usage.


Targeted at golf course superintendents, groundskeepers, and other water management specialists, this certificate program focuses on the principles and practices of efficient water use, conservation, and management.


Through a combination of theoretical and practical training, learners will gain a deep understanding of water management strategies, including irrigation system design, water quality monitoring, and drought management.


By the end of the program, learners will be equipped to develop and implement effective water management plans that minimize environmental impact while maintaining the health and beauty of golf courses.

Course Content

• Water Auditing • Water Conservation • Irrigation System Design • Hydrology • Water Quality Management • Drainage Design • Water Harvesting • Turfgrass Management • Water Efficiency Measures • Environmental Impact Assessment

Assessment

The evaluation process is conducted through the submission of assignments, and there are no written examinations involved.
